|
主题: 好郁闷呀!!!问题百出,请好心人指点
|
 e云
职务:普通成员
等级:1
金币:0.0
发贴:28
注册:2001/8/10 14:44:53
|
#12001/11/27 22:10:14
近日好郁闷呀!!!问题层出不穷
我在一个框架结构中插入了一个DirectMedia Xtras,在控制播放时为什么他总是自动播放第一个文件?? 我本为是用按钮控制多个播放文件的,怎样才能让它不自动播放??是不是有一些函数或其它控制???
在插入Xtras时为什么总有一个黑框在屏幕上显示??? 非得用一个擦除图标,在用Authorware5时没有这个问题
|
 与人同乐
职务:管理员
等级:6
金币:18.0
发贴:3928
注册:2001/3/11 15:45:42
|
#22001/11/27 23:32:02
 打开pause at start复选框,就可以避免自动播放了。
|
 e云
职务:普通成员
等级:1
金币:0.0
发贴:28
注册:2001/8/10 14:44:53
|
#32001/11/28 17:19:43
为什么我在开始设置时选中了Paused at start,但在调试过程中它自己又改成了未选中呀???
|
 与人同乐
职务:管理员
等级:6
金币:18.0
发贴:3928
注册:2001/3/11 15:45:42
|
#42001/11/28 18:26:43
通常情况下不会出现这种现象……除非使用了代码如SetIconProperty等对图标的属性进行了修改。
|
 e云
职务:普通成员
等级:1
金币:0.0
发贴:28
注册:2001/8/10 14:44:53
|
#52001/11/29 17:03:18
我是用了SetIconproperty,是因为我在DMX中设置了Pause at start,它是不自动播放,但是在点击按钮后它还是不播放第一个文件,但可以播放其他文件,当现在再点击第一个文件时才能正常播放。
我搞不清楚为什么在框架中的交互第一按钮是自动启用
|
 与人同乐
职务:管理员
等级:6
金币:18.0
发贴:3928
注册:2001/3/11 15:45:42
|
#62001/12/1 13:02:23
在Directmediaxtra图标之前,用这个试试: SetIconProperty(@"DirectMediaXtra", #file,"yourfirstmovie")
|
 e云
职务:普通成员
等级:1
金币:0.0
发贴:28
注册:2001/8/10 14:44:53
|
#72001/12/2 17:49:10
我用了一笨办法将自动播放的问题解决掉了,我加了一个空图标。
但DirectMediaXtras控件插入后的黑色显示区域一直也屏蔽不掉,程序运行过控件后屏幕上就显示播放AVI的一黑色块,怎样将它屏蔽掉?在DirectMediaXtras设置中有一个选项是显示与否的选项但怎样用函数来控制它???或有什么其它的方法吗?
|
 e云
职务:普通成员
等级:1
金币:0.0
发贴:28
注册:2001/8/10 14:44:53
|
#82001/12/3 17:02:28
Y
除了在测试时停止播放可更改视频的显示窗口外,还可用什么函数还是有什么方法改变?
因为我发现,不管在什么版本中好象都有这种黑区情况,只不过非常小而已
|
 与人同乐
职务:管理员
等级:6
金币:18.0
发贴:3928
注册:2001/3/11 15:45:42
|
#92001/12/3 20:22:23
似乎没有你要的函数。DirectMedia Xtra提供的videowidth与videoheight也都是只读的属性。
另外黑区问题我从未遇到过,应该是显示卡与DirectMedia之间的兼容性问题,不妨升级你的显示卡驱动程序试一下。
|